Ok yeah i thought you were talking about CREATING an account which is incredibly simple. But storing keys and dealing with keys is a brand new and often challenging world for most new users. Agreed.

Also the aspect of having them do their own transactions by running independent software (keychain, peaklock or hivesigner). They're used to having the website do the transactions for them. However keys come with ownership and that's the main product in my opinion that we offer that other content platforms do not offer and keys and several independent signing tools are the main reason we can offer true ownership. So it's hard to be mad at the complexity of keys ... BUT... we still need to find a creative solution to helping new users.

That's why it would be nice to have an easy way to create wallets with a simple pair of keys (like ETH) that can only store and transfer tokens. These addresses could be some alphanumeric mess to distinguish them from "social" Hive accounts.
It increases safety because people have an easy and familiar way to store HIVE off exchanges.

we are one of the only blockchains to have "human readable" addresses. In that sense we are more user friendly than all those other blockchains. This is our advantage.

Ofc. But it needs to be obvious to distinguish a light account from a "social" one. And we don't need to create an easy way to squat names.
